| ZEROMQ :: POLLER :: TIMER Simple Timer voor gebruik met ZEROMQ :: Poller |
Download nu |
ZEROMQ :: POLLER :: TIMER Rangschikking & Samenvatting
- Vergunning:
- Perl Artistic License
- Naam uitgever:
- James Conerly
- Uitgever website:
- http://search.cpan.org/~jconerly/
ZEROMQ :: POLLER :: TIMER Tags
ZEROMQ :: POLLER :: TIMER Beschrijving
ZEROMQ :: POLLER is een PERL-module die op ZEROMQ-sockets voor evenementen wacht, en als u een daemon schrijft, zou u dit meestal in een oneindige lus doen. Als er echter niets gebeurt op die stopcontacten, dan blokkeert ZEROMQ :: Poller gewoon op de methode van de poll () voor onbepaalde tijd. Daemons wilden periodiek dingen doen, zoals het herladen van configuratiebestanden, praten met databases of procesbanen die de eerste keer niet slagen. Turent, ZEROMQ :: Poller heeft geen ingebouwde functionaliteit om u periodiek uit te steken () en werk werk. Dit is dus mijn poging om periodieke timerfunctionaliteit toe te voegen aan Zeromq :: Poller, met behulp van Zeromq.zeromq :: Poller :: timer is een eenvoudige, anyevent-achtige timer voor gebruik met ZEROMQ :: Poller. Net als een AnyEvent Timer kunt u elke timer instellen om een keer af te vuren, of met tussenpozen. Het ondersteunt momenteel geen callback-functie en misschien nooit. De timer is gewoon een manier om het mogelijk te maken om periodiek uit te breken van de blokkerende oproep tot poll (), zodat u andere Daemony Stuff kunt doen. Synopsis Gebruik ZEROMQ :: POLLER :: TIMER; Mijn $ timer = ZEROMQ :: POLLER :: TIMER-> NIEUW (NAAM => 'MY_TIMER', # Vereist na => $ seconden, # Vereist Interval => $ seconden, PAUZE => , # Standaardinstellingen voor 0); Homepage van het product
ZEROMQ :: POLLER :: TIMER Gerelateerde software